OPP announce auto theft arrests

Ontario Provincial Police and the Canada Border Services Agency recovered more than 300 stolen vehicles in what was called Project Chickadee.  As Sean O’Shea reports, authorities say they’ve successfully dismantled an auto theft criminal organization.
